Description
Organizes, files, and retrieves patient medical records. Files various medical documentation, including patient notes, radiology reports, and lab results. Performs related clerical duties. May be responsible for clerical duties related to patient admission/discharge. Works with both paper-based systems and electronic medical records (EMR). Ensures medical records are maintained in a manner compliant with ethical, legal and regulatory requirements of the medical services system.
Responsibilities:
Organize and evaluate medical records for completeness and accuracy.
Close and file discharged patients' medical charts. Review charts of discharged patients for deficient information and ensure compliance for correction of deficient documentation.
Generate and prepare/assemble medical records.
Pull and route records as requested to appropriate personnel or department.
Pull charts as needed for special audits and peer review.
Create reports when required.
Prepare copy of records when presented with properly completed medical release forms.
Perform a variety of administrative duties including but not limited to: answering phones; faxing and filing of confidential documents; and basic Internet and email utilization.
Maintain effective communication with others, both inside and outside the department, to give or obtain needed information or coordinate activities of patients (e.g., doctors' appointments).
Update job knowledge by participating in educational opportunities.
Perform other related duties as required and directed.
